=============================================== Duktape 1.x compatible module loading framework =============================================== The default built-in module loading framework was removed in Duktape 2.x because more flexibility was needed for module loading. This directory contains a Duktape 1.x compatible module loading framework which you can add to your build: * Add ``duk_module_duktape.c`` to list of C sources to compile. * Ensure ``duk_module_duktape.h`` is in the include path. * Include the extra header in calling code and initialize the bindings:: #include "duktape.h" #include "duk_module_duktape.h" /* After initializing the Duktape heap or when creating a new * thread with a new global environment: */ duk_module_duktape_init(ctx); Don't call ``duk_module_duktape_init()`` more than once for the same global environment. * As usual in Duktape 1.x, you should define ``Duktape.modSearch()`` to provide environment specific module lookups. * After these steps, ``require()`` will be registered to the global object and the module system is ready to use.
